11:00 am
"Podcasting: New Opportunities in Dramatic Storytelling"
Justin Glanville & Angie Hayes

In this presentation, writer Justin Glanville and sound designer Angie Hayes will talk about creating the scripted audio drama Munchen, Minnesota. They'll share stories about writing in an audio-only, serialized format, as well as how they cast, record, and sound-design each episode.

1:30 pm
"Crafting the Screenplay: Three-act Structure"
Simone Barros

One of the building blocks of the screenwriting craft is the three-act structure. In this workshop, novice screenwriters will gain a deeper understanding of that structure--including the inciting incident, climax, and dénouement--while more experienced screenwriters will enhance their creative problem-solving techniques. For playwrights, this workshop serves as a great way to step into screenwriting, as the craft of playwriting directly translates into the form.
